A model rocket is launched straight upward. The path of the rocket is modeled by h = -16t2 + 200t, where h represents the height of the rocket and t represents the time in seconds. a. What is its maximum height? b. Is it still in the air after 8 seconds? Explain why or why not. c. Is it still in the air after 14 seconds? Explain why or why not.
